Key Responsibilities :
- Support Paragon’s product certification and regulatory efforts to enable worldwide sale of water treatment products.
- Serve as the point of contact for certification entities, regulatory agencies, and independent laboratories including WQA, NSF, IAPMO, and other international bodies.
- Manage and maintain Private Label (ANF) listings and ensure accurate documentation for all certifications.
- Handle state product registrations (applications, renewals, modifications) and maintain compliance with FIFRA and state EPA registration requirements.
- Organize and maintain Paragon’s test report tracking system and documentation library.
- Prepare and submit product certification applications, supporting documentation, and physical samples for testing and evaluation.
- Partner with 3rd party suppliers and overseas manufacturers to coordinate certifications, registrations, and required inspections.
- Communicate and collaborate with FilterPro’s Regulatory Department and other company divisions as needed.
- Assist in managing regulatory project budgets and expense tracking.
- Respond to customer inquiries and provide documentation for compliance with standards such as California Prop 65, ACS (France), REACH, RoHS, WaterMark (Australia), and others.
